本文目录导读:
图片来源于网络,如有侵权联系删除
随着云计算和虚拟化技术的飞速发展,虚拟化集群已成为企业数据中心和云服务提供商构建高效、灵活、可扩展的计算环境的重要手段,虚拟化集群的搭建方法多种多样,每种方法都有其独特的优势和适用场景,以下是几种常见的虚拟化集群搭建方法及其类型,旨在帮助读者全面了解虚拟化集群的构建过程。
基于硬件虚拟化的集群搭建方法
1、VMware vSphere
VMware vSphere 是目前市场上最为成熟、应用广泛的虚拟化平台之一,基于硬件虚拟化的集群搭建方法主要包括以下步骤:
(1)选择合适的硬件设备,如服务器、存储和网络设备等。
(2)安装 VMware ESXi,作为虚拟化主机。
(3)创建虚拟机(VM),将应用程序和操作系统部署在虚拟机中。
(4)配置 vCenter Server,实现虚拟机集群管理。
(5)设置高可用性(HA)和故障转移(FT)策略,确保集群的稳定运行。
2、Microsoft Hyper-V
Microsoft Hyper-V 是 Windows Server 操作系统自带的一种虚拟化技术,基于硬件虚拟化的集群搭建方法与 VMware vSphere 类似,具体步骤如下:
(1)选择合适的硬件设备。
(2)在 Windows Server 上安装 Hyper-V 角色。
(3)创建虚拟机,部署应用程序和操作系统。
图片来源于网络,如有侵权联系删除
(4)配置 Hyper-V Manager,实现虚拟机集群管理。
(5)设置 HA 和 FT 策略,提高集群的可靠性。
基于容器化的集群搭建方法
1、Docker Swarm
Docker Swarm 是一种基于容器的集群管理工具,可以将多个 Docker 容器部署在同一个集群中,基于容器化的集群搭建方法主要包括以下步骤:
(1)安装 Docker 引擎。
(2)创建 Docker Swarm 集群。
(3)将容器部署到集群中。
(4)配置服务发现、负载均衡和滚动更新等功能。
2、Kubernetes
Kubernetes 是一个开源的容器编排平台,可以用于自动化容器的部署、扩展和管理,基于容器化的集群搭建方法主要包括以下步骤:
(1)选择合适的硬件设备。
(2)安装 Kubernetes 集群,包括 master 节点和 worker 节点。
(3)部署应用程序和容器。
图片来源于网络,如有侵权联系删除
(4)配置服务发现、负载均衡、自动扩展和故障转移等功能。
基于虚拟化与容器结合的集群搭建方法
1、Kubernetes on VMware vSphere
Kubernetes on VMware vSphere 是一种将 Kubernetes 与 VMware vSphere 结合起来的集群搭建方法,具体步骤如下:
(1)在 VMware vSphere 上安装 Kubernetes 集群。
(2)将虚拟机部署在 Kubernetes 集群中。
(3)配置服务发现、负载均衡和自动扩展等功能。
2、Kubernetes on Hyper-V
Kubernetes on Hyper-V 是一种将 Kubernetes 与 Microsoft Hyper-V 结合起来的集群搭建方法,具体步骤如下:
(1)在 Windows Server 上安装 Kubernetes 集群。
(2)将虚拟机部署在 Kubernetes 集群中。
(3)配置服务发现、负载均衡和自动扩展等功能。
虚拟化集群搭建方法多种多样,包括基于硬件虚拟化、容器化和虚拟化与容器结合的集群搭建方法,每种方法都有其独特的优势和适用场景,企业在选择合适的虚拟化集群搭建方法时,应根据自身业务需求、技术水平和成本预算等因素进行综合考虑,通过深入了解各种虚拟化集群搭建方法,有助于企业构建高效、稳定的计算环境,提升业务竞争力。
标签: #虚拟化集群搭建方法有几种类型有哪些
评论列表